The IKA Screening System is perfectly tailored to electrosynthesis with constant current in multibatch mode. The packages with 6 divided pot cells allow you to research several samples at the same time. You can also combine the system with other laboratory equipment.
In the divided electrolysis cells, six divided cells can be used in conjunction with the screening system.
The divided reaction cells consist of a reaction block, which has two separate Elektrodenhalbraume.
These are connected by a glass frit. Thus, an electrochemical reaction may take place, but the reaction liquids remain substantially separate from each other. The mixing of the anolyte and catholyte is thus prevented.
This is of particular interest if the product produced at the counter electrode should not be stable.

The IKA Screening System is perfectly tailored to electrosynthesis with constant current in multibatch mode. The packages with 8 undivided pot cells allow you to research several samples at the same time. You can also combine the system with other laboratory equipment.
The use of the screening system with undivided electrolysis cells allows you to individually configure each individual electrolysis cell.
By means of two DC power sources, which each have four outputs, a voltage of 0 - 32 V or 0 - 10 A current can be set independently. The assembly of the reaction cells takes place either with electrodes of different or the same materials, depending on which electrosynthesis you would like to carry out. The reaction cells are arranged in a heating block, which is heated if necessary via the magnetic stirrer supplied. An external PT 1000 temperature sensor ensures the monitoring and control of the exact heating block temperature.
